It’s no secret that resources are quite important in My Time at Sandrock. But equally as important is money, which is called Gols in the game. You’ll need plenty of Gols for a lot of stuff, such as buying goods and services, traveling from one place to another, and upgrading your inventory size.
However, if you’re unsure how you can make lots of Gols in the game, then this guide is for you.
How to Make More Money in My Time at Sandrock

One thing you have to keep in mind when it comes to playing My Time at Sandrock is that nothing happens fast. This means that if you want to make more money, you have to take it slow. Similar to My Time at Portia, your main method of making money is via commissions from the board you can find in Yan’s store.
These commissions will give you hundreds, even thousands, of Gols upon completion depending on its tier. On average, a one-star commission could give you around 100-200 Gols on average while a three-star commission could give you as much as 2000 Gols.
Aside from commissions, another means of making Gols in the game is by selling stuff you don’t need. As you collect resources and materials, you’ll eventually have a lot of overstocked stuff in your inventory.
Things like Plants and Honey, for example, will sell for a decent amount of Gols. Just make sure to keep your essential items like Dinas and Stones untouched.
Increasing Your Gol Earnings

Commissions give a lot of Gols, but you can further increase the amount of Gols you receive upon completion. This is by leveling up your Social Knowledge tree, specifically the nodes that increase reward bonuses from successful commission completion.
Here are some really good examples:
- Quick Delivery – 5% more reward bonus if you complete a commission within the same day
- Quality Bonus – 10% more reward bonus if you turn in a higher-quality item than requested
- Chart-topper – 5% more reward bonus if you managed to be part of the top 3 at the Commerce Guild
